Output 6438566ae59d6a3a4727e183871ee9465315dbadb44b3584f0faf80c1837081c:0

value
31222107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 704c5c970c5c8dc00a10c6d3dcb81bd00f29afd3 OP_EQUAL
address
MJ8wPcnGxs46yDAaF8ctLrvx1sgTP1gaKQ
transaction
6438566ae59d6a3a4727e183871ee9465315dbadb44b3584f0faf80c1837081c
spent
true